## Deployment

Nightfill, our scheduler for nightly data backfills, deploys as a single worker pool behind the Harborline gateway. For the eng sync: deploys happen via the standard pipeline, but note that in-flight backfills are drained before the new version takes traffic, which can add up to twenty minutes. Always verify the drain completed in the dashboard before marking the deploy done. On startup, the scheduler reads the following configuration values:

config for yajep-tafof:
[rusath]
team = julmir
access_code = ac_fe37fd
host = rusath.novactech.test
port = 8000
owner = pelmir.weneth
peer = oliwyn.olvarqdyn.internal

Hi, and welcome to the Quillmark rotation. A recurring source of pages is date formatting in the Tidewatch dashboard: some locales render day-first, others month-first, and our fallback logic has historically guessed wrong for a handful of regions. Before changing any locale mapping, confirm the affected region in the triage sheet and test against the staging renderer. Never hotfix format strings directly in production. The complete localization checklist, including approved locale overrides, is kept on this internal page.

operations page: https://jira.tolvaqlabs.internal/pages/projects/display/browse/e69d

- [ ] Before the Quillhaven signing ceremony proceeds, run the leaked-file-descriptor hunt on the offline signer. As a new contractor, please be thorough: enumerate every open descriptor on the sealed host, confirm nothing points at the ceremony scratch volume, and log each finding in the Larkspur register. If any descriptor traces back to the retired Fenwick exporter, halt and page the ceremony lead. Once the host shows a clean descriptor table, unlock the escrow envelope using the phrase below.

unlock words, yajof-tagef: aldiel-kasath-briax-fraeth-pelius-olieth-pelix-wenius-wenael-norael